Two men, Lyndell Mays and Dominic Miller, have been charged with second-degree murder and multiple weapons counts in connection with a shooting at a Kansas City Super Bowl victory rally that left one person dead and over 20 injured. The altercation began over eye contact and quickly escalated into a gunfight, with Mays and Miller both firing weapons. The incident marked at least the 48th mass shooting in the US in 2024, according to the Gun Violence Archive.
